How do I prepare for my first appointment with Dr. Ellis in Houston?

Bring a list of current medications, any prior imaging or lab results related to your condition, and a summary of your symptoms including when they started. Arriving a few minutes early to complete intake paperwork will help ensure your visit runs smoothly. Her office staff can advise you on any additional preparation steps when you schedule.
